Output 9c5d8ed688ae341c714626855b81a237b84ea31653133d4b6105fbb6636c31cb:2

value
19683083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fbde1e7803b27e78de358eb1839b099258bd63 OP_EQUAL
address
35hahs3uPFgMzY31XPb956pn8pV4weiYWr
transaction
9c5d8ed688ae341c714626855b81a237b84ea31653133d4b6105fbb6636c31cb
spent
true